Answer:
The number of ways to form different groups of four subjects is 4845.
Step-by-step explanation:
In mathematics, the procedure to select k items from n distinct items, without replacement, is known as combinations.
The formula to compute the combinations of k items from n is given by the formula:

In this case, 4 subjects are randomly selected from a group of 20 subjects.
Compute the number of ways to form different groups of four subjects as follows:



Thus, the number of ways to form different groups of four subjects is 4845.
